    Pittsburgh ranks 27th in Yards Per Attempt via this link here. If one elects to glance at the "last three" option however, Pittsburgh is much better; 12th being their ranking if just accounting for the previous three. Of the two, I would use the previous three rankings as a more accurate methodology as the Offensive Line was still very much in development within the first four weeks and thus, is not a good indicator of the Offenses overall abilities as there are big play options available.



    This all said, one aspect that has to be taken into account is Big Ben actually pushing the ball down the deep middle of the field more so than he has during the first five weeks. Prior to that, pass attempts in the deep sidelines to the sidelines themselves were his main bread and butter. This seems to be no longer the case; doubly so if Pat Freiermuth can continue his ascension with the continual improvement of the Offensive Line.



    In short? The Matt Canada Offense has had its fair share of ups and downs this season; some more egregious than others. However, the concern of this Offense was never about how it would look coming out of the gates but how quickly and efficiently it could improve over the course of the season. So far, proof positive indeed. That said, need to continue to do so if the Steelers are to continually stack wins; reach their goal of the playoffs doubly so.
